A roof is the protection of your home, and a freshly painted roof can improve its curb appeal dramatically. But before you grab a brush and jump into the project, it's crucial to master the steps involved for a smooth finish.
- To begin with, examine your roof thoroughly for any damage or loose shingles. Repairing these issues before painting will ensure a durable and long-lasting result.
- Next, scrub the roof surface using a pressure washer or broom to remove dirt, debris, and moss. Allow the roof to dry completely before proceeding.
- At this point, spread a primer designed for roofs. This will create a bond for the paint to adhere securely to.
- When the primer is cured, it's time to apply the roof with your chosen paint. Use a roller for larger areas and a brush for edges. Spread multiple thin coats rather than one thick coat for optimal coverage.
Be aware that painting a roof can be a demanding task. If you're uncomfortable, it's best to consult a professional contractor for the job.

A key factor to consider when choosing a roof coating is its material. Common materials include silicone, each offering unique features. Acrylic coatings are renowned for their budget-friendliness and ease of application, while polyurethane coatings provide superior elasticity and defenses against UV rays. Silicone coatings, on the other hand, are highly heat-resistant, helping to minimize your energy consumption.
Moreover, it's essential to choose a roof coating that is suitable for your existing roofing system. Speaking with a qualified roofing professional can help you determine the most ideal solution for your specific needs and climate.

Choosing the Right Paint for a Weatherproof Roof
Your roof serves as your home's primary line of defense from the elements. So, when it comes to choosing paint, you need something that can hold up to even the toughest weather conditions.
Latex paints are a well-regarded choice for roofs because they're long-lasting. They also provide good shielding against UV rays, which can bleach your roof over time.
When choosing paint for your roof, take into account the climate you live in. If you live in an area with a lot of moisture, look for a paint that has high waterproofing properties.
Similarly, if your area experiences extreme temperatures, choose a paint that can flex with the variations in temperature.
